Output 1b63c95066cdc0f052d31b95c8afb2cb196c62f797071c9fd4029beb9bbe4d81:1

value
760062
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 172ec6e4087571f67fc53e53f183449dc1e3a1a9 OP_EQUALVERIFY OP_CHECKSIG
address
137aaXhUGhZEc243rThPVqtcX3cc2ycotP
transaction
1b63c95066cdc0f052d31b95c8afb2cb196c62f797071c9fd4029beb9bbe4d81
confirmations
125189
spent
true